A surprise from Lamborghini at Geneva? - 02-15-2006, 03:22 AM



Our french friends at Le Blog Auto let us know that Stephan Winkelmann, Lamborghini CEO, said that "there will be a nice surprise for visitors to the Geneva Auto Show".

If the nice surprise is just the European premiere for the Miura Concept, we'll be a bit disappointed. We hope it's something a bit more substantial, but declarations like "we're a small business and we can't immediately build all models that we'd like to" and "we don't intend selling too many Lambos"" non lasciano molto posto per voli di fantasia.

The most down-to-earht hypothesis is the rear-wheel drive Gallardo, to differentiate it from the Audi R8, but it might be a Q7-based LM 00x SUV or an Espada 2+2 coupè (in the sketches), which is less likely because of the high development costs associated with a front-engined Lamborghini.
